Citizens Provides Nearly $134M Loan to Longfellow Real Estate Partners

The funds from will finance the acquisition of a two building lab project in Emeryville, CA.

EMERYVILLE, CA—Citizens recently revealed that its Commercial Real Estate Finance team provided a $133.6-million loan to Boston-based Longfellow Real Estate Partners for the development of a new 190,000 square-foot life science lab complex in Emeryville, CA. Citizens is Sole Lead Arranger, Sole Bookrunner and Administrative Agent.

The funds are being used for the acquisition and conversion of industrial warehouse space into Atrium Labs, a two-building lab project located at 1650 65th St. and 6601-6603 Shellmound St. in Emeryville’s growing life science hub.
